☐ Lost-badge walk-through (Day 1, reception). When a new starter at Ferndale Atrium reports a lost badge, don't panic them — it happens weekly. Log it in the Gatebook, deactivate the old badge via the Kestrel panel, and issue a paper visitor sticker for the rest of the day. Remind them replacement badges come from Security on Level 3, usually within two hours. So they're not stranded at the turnstiles in the meantime, give them the temporary door code below.

door code, bafog-bawif: bdg-LBEEAI-75528164

Subject: Raffle drums for Friday's staff party

Hi dispatch team,

The two wooden raffle drums from the Pennybrook office are boxed and ready at the mailroom counter. They're heavier than they look, so send them with the afternoon van, not the bike courier. Our events lead, Marta Quill, will sign at the Fernhall site. When the driver arrives, hand-over goes as follows.

handover note for yagef-bagep: the drudor pelius courier leaves the kasdor zorvan norir ledger at gate 8016 under passcode 755406

## Fan-out Backpressure

Pushfield fans notifications out to device channels via Quillfeather workers. When downstream queues exceed the high-water mark, producers throttle automatically; do not disable this manually. Symptoms of saturation: rising publish latency, shed low-priority batches. First response: check worker pool health, then queue depth. Full backpressure tuning guidance is on the internal engineering page.

wiki page, hahog-yahog: https://jira.plorvaworks.corp/display/dash/pages/pages/repo/display/spaces/7b9c5df2c5490ad9694860b5

Ticket #—: Rotabot's secrets vault sealed itself again after the 02:00 rotation run hit the API timeout three times. Rotations are paused, so nothing's broken yet, but the grace window closes in ~10 hours. Restart the agent first; if it still reports sealed, you'll have to unseal manually from the admin shell. The manual unseal prompts for the recovery passphrase, which is:

recovery phrase for tafof-tagag: kaseth-brivan-pelmir-istmir-istax-pelath-sorael-praax-sorix-norwyn-frador-praok-istir-juleth